Course goals

Provide the student with basic knowledge and experimentation skills that are used in the field of neuropsychopharmacological research.
Specific aims:
1: obtaining the experience of conducting animal experiments.
2: observe, test and interpret animal behavior in the context of neuropsychopharmacological research.
3: learn how to plan, setup and perform experiments in the psychopharmacology field
4: develop skills that enable clear reproducible experimental data acquisition
5: learn how to analyze data and make clear usable scientific reports

Working methods
In this practical course the students will experience what it’s like to participate in neuropsychopharmacological research. They will learn how to set-up and conduct a neuropsychopharmacological experiment and use different experimentation techniques. The analysis of behavioral data and different ways of reporting and presenting these results will be another part of the course. The work in this course involves animal experiments and research in humans. All this is performed in the framework of the development of new therapeutics for psychiatric disorders. At the end of the course each student has learned how to to conduct neuropsychopharmacological experiments, analyze and interpret data and present these data in a scientific way.
 
Contents
This course contains different practicums that will give a close view of research in the neuropsychopharmacology field. Animal handling, observation techniques, behavioral testing and the influence of different drugs on behavior will be experienced up close. The course contains both animal experimentation and research in human subjects. You will learn about the practical and ethical considerations in animal and human research. The practical handling and the experimental results will be analyzed and presented in a written report. This course will give you the “look and feel” of what neuropsychopharmacology research is all about.
